Data model¶
Refindery's relational state lives in the metadata store (SQLite in WAL mode by default). Vectors live in the vector store; the query log lives in DuckDB. This page describes the relational shape; the corresponding Python types are in the domain models reference.
Core entities¶
| Table | Grain | Notes |
|---|---|---|
pages |
one row per canonical_url |
Never versioned. Carries body_text, content_hash, visit_count, and status. |
chunks |
one row per (page, ordinal) | Canonical, model-independent spans — all models embed the same chunking. |
embedding_models |
one row per model | Exactly one is_active; status ∈ registered\|backfilling\|ready\|retired. |
page_vectors |
(page, model) | L2-normalized pooled page vector; drives clustering and similar_to. |
Entities¶
| Table | Grain | Notes |
|---|---|---|
entities |
canonical entity | canonical_form, type, mention_count, page_count, idf. |
entity_aliases |
(surface_form, entity) | Normalized surface forms linking to an entity. |
entity_mentions |
mention | Per-page/chunk mentions with character offsets. |
Canonicalization is corpus-internal — see Entities.
Clusters¶
| Table | Grain | Notes |
|---|---|---|
clusters |
stable cluster | id survives re-clustering; label, keywords, tombstoned_at. |
cluster_members |
(cluster, page) | HDBSCAN soft-membership probability. |
cluster_runs |
run | Trigger, algorithm, params, counts, timing. |
cluster_lineage |
event | created\|persisted\|split\|merged\|dissolved with Jaccard and parents. |
Stable IDs come from a Jaccard + Hungarian matching layer — see Clustering.
Operational tables¶
| Table | Purpose |
|---|---|
blacklist |
URL/domain rules; a match makes ingest return 403. |
jobs |
Durable queue ledger: kind, payload, status, attempts, lease_until. |
Jobs are lease-based and idempotent (job key = (page_id, content_hash) for
indexing) — see Operations.
Dialect-neutral DDL
The schema uses no SQLite-specific SQL outside the adapter, and the
MetadataStore port is dialect-neutral, so a Postgres adapter is a v2 drop-in.
